Oldham Integrated Community Diabetes Service
The service is for adults aged 18 years and above, who have diabetes, are registered with a GP in the Oldham borough and meet the service referral criteria
The majority of diabetes care will be delivered within the local community.
Dependant on the complexity of your condition, you could be cared for by the Oldham Diabetes Service or by your GP practice. The majority of patient’s referred into the service will be discharged back to their own GP practice once individual goals are being achieved.
The service also provides education sessions to patients, GP’s and primary care clinicians.
The service aims to provide the following benefits
- A better experience overall
- Excellent quality of care
- Improved co-ordination of care
- Reduce risk of hospital admission with diabetes related problems
- Specialist diabetes care closer to home for the majority of people.
